                #67
                I got mine at Belle Tire for $48/wheel with the center caps included...the chrome lugs were an extra $20...avergage price for those.
                The particular brand that Belle Tire carries for my wheels(also made by Cragar and many others) is AWC...Im not sure what it stands for...I want to say Allied Wheel Company.


                the center caps I got are just plain smooth...but I'm thinking of getting some spoked ones if I can...



                these are so glossay and shiny in person...you woul dlove them...and they pretty easy to clean.
                9/10 times I just take a Microfiber towel and 2-3 sprays of Quick Detailer and its clean....unless it gets mud on it or something like that...then I use a hose and wheel cleaner
                if you dont really need raised white letter tires like I have...you can also get these in 16s and I believe in 17s as well.
